How To Create a New Contact in Schedule Plus from Visual Basic

Article translations Article translations
Article ID: 161343 - View products that this article applies to.
This article was previously published under Q161343
Expand all | Collapse all

SUMMARY

This article demonstrates how to use Visual Basic to add a contact to Schedule Plus.

MORE INFORMATION

  1. Start a new Standard EXE project. Form1 is added by default.
  2. Add the following code to Form1's Click event procedure:
          Private Sub Form1_Click()
             Dim objSchdPlus As Object
             Dim objContact As Object
    
             Set objSchdPlus = CreateObject("SchedulePlus.Application")
             objSchdPlus.Logon
             Set objContact = objSchdPlus.ScheduleSelected.Contacts.New
             objContact.SetProperties FirstName:="Santa", _
                LastName:="Claus", PhoneBusiness:="(206)555-4321", _
                PhoneHome:="(206)555-6789"
             objSchdPlus.Logoff
             Set objContact = Nothing
             Set objSchdPlus = Nothing
           End Sub
    						
  3. Start Microsoft Schedule Plus.
  4. Press the F5 key to run the program. Click the form, and then view your list of contacts in Schedule Plus to see the new entry.
NOTE: If Schedule Plus is not running, the above code will result in run- time error 450: Wrong number of arguments or invalid property assignment.

Properties

Article ID: 161343 - Last Review: June 29, 2004 - Revision: 2.1
APPLIES TO
  • Microsoft Visual Basic 5.0 Learning Edition
  • Microsoft Visual Basic 5.0 Professional Edition
  • Microsoft Visual Basic 5.0 Enterprise Edition
Keywords: 
kbhowto kbprogramming KB161343
Retired KB Content Disclaimer
This article was written about products for which Microsoft no longer offers support. Therefore, this article is offered "as is" and will no longer be updated.

Give Feedback

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com